Jim entered Presidio Sport and Medicine July 11, 2001
in a wheelchair. Due to a fall, which required surgery
and the placement of hardware in his heels to stabilize
the fractures, he was unable to bear weight through
his legs for 2.5 months. As a result, he had significant
difficulty regaining his ability to walk once his fractures
had healed.
After months of hard work and perseverance Jim is now
able to walk at a normal pace -- up and down stairs
and hills. He has regained about 90% of his capabilities
prior to his accident and continues to get stronger.
